The first time the clarinet was used in an orchestral setting was in vivaldi’s “juditha triumphans”, which was written in around 1715 or 1716 (niu.edu). The history of the clarinet dates back to the early 18th century when it was first invented by johann christoph denner, a renowned woodwind maker in nürnberg. The clarinet was invented by jc denner of nuremberg in germany in 1700. Denner had been experimenting with a peasant pipe called the chalumeau, which used a slip of cane as a single reed, beating against the slanted end of the tube. It played a scale of nine simple notes, and produced a very low sound.
